Josh Brolin and Miles Teller join Sean Penn in Flag Day

June 23, 2019 by Gary Collinson

With filming about to begin, THR is reporting that Only the Brave co-stars Josh Brolin and Miles Teller have signed on for roles in Flag Day, the latest directorial effort from Sean Penn.

The film has been scripted by Tony-winning playwright Jez Butterworth and is based on Jennifer Vogel’s memoir Flim-Flam Man: The True Story of My Father’s Counterfeit Life. It tells the story of “a daughter that has to come to terms with her perceptions of her criminal father, a bank robber and career counterfeiter that evaded arrest for six months.”

In addition to directing, Penn will also star in the film alongside his daughter Dylan and son Hopper, while the cast also includes Norbert Leo Butz (Luce), Dale Dickey (Hell or High Water), Eddie Marsan (Fast & Furious Presents: Hobbs and Shaw), Bailey Noble (True Blood) and Katheryn Winnick (Vikings).
